I have decided to part with my Scrapps near set (including 3 of the 4 HOFers). Over half the cards in this grouping are very presentable with great fronts, however, there are some lower grade cards as well, and one or two fillers. All of these exhibit some evidence of having been in a scrapbook at one point, whether that be glue residue or staining or some glue still present and some do exhibit some paper loss. Those with experience with this set know the extremely thin cardstock and the difficulty in finding even presentable cards.
Front scans are below for all 14 cards in this lot. The full Scrapps set is mad up of 18 cards, so the purchaser would only be 4 cards away from a truly tough 19th Century set, and if they are so inclined my brother (Rhys) currently has a nice Sam Thompson on his website www.prewarsports.com that would only leave 3 cards for completion (Getzein, Rowe, and White).
